奇异

奇異
qíyì
adjective #8,747

Meanings

  1. 1 strange; bizarre; peculiar
  2. 2 fantastical; wondrous

Examples

Tā jiǎng le yī gè qíyì de gùshi.
He told a strange story.
Zhè zuò dǎo shang yǒu hěn duō qíyì de zhíwù.
There are many peculiar plants on this island.
Qíyì Bóshì shì Mànwēi de chāojí yīngxióng.
Doctor Strange is a Marvel superhero.

Tips

usage
奇异 emphasizes the unusual and extraordinary, often with a sense of wonder. Compare: 奇怪 (qíguài) is more colloquial and means 'weird/odd,' while 奇异 is more literary and can carry positive connotations of the marvelous.

In Pop Culture

奇异博士 Qíyì Bóshì
Doctor Strange
Marvel superhero and sorcerer, played by Benedict Cumberbatch in the MCU
奇异 qíyìguǒ
kiwifruit
The Chinese name for kiwifruit, literally 'strange fruit'
